On Dec. 9, Carolina students, faculty and staff can help people who depend on lifesaving blood donations when the University hosts its 16th annual Holiday Carolina Blood Drive. Campus and community members can donate blood from 7:30 a.m. to 1 p.m. in Fetzer Hall on South Road. Free parking is available in the Cobb Deck off Country Club Road.

Through the blood drive, sponsored by the Employee Forum and American Red Cross Blood Services, donations will benefit local patients as well as those across the country. Last year’s holiday drive collected 310 pints of blood, potentially touching or saving the lives of 930 patients in need of blood products. Of the 293 donors, 29 were first-time givers.
